Hok Canyon
Hok Canyon is a valley in Sierra, New Mexico and has an elevation of 5,453 feet.- Type: Valley with an elevation of 5,453 feet
- Description: valley in Sierra County, New Mexico, United States of America
- Category: landform
- Location: Sierra, New Mexico, Southwest, United States, North America
